Three years before the famous events in New York, transgender women and drag queens in San Francisco’s Tenderloin district stood up against systemic police harassment. The riot at Gene Compton’s Cafeteria marked one of the first recorded instances of collective, physical resistance to the oppression of queer people in United States history. In the United States, GLAAD's ALERT Desk catalogued across 47 states and Washington, D.C., in 2025—a five percent increase over 2024. Over half of these incidents targeted transgender and other gender non-conforming individuals, a 10% increase from the previous year. Pride Month 2025 alone saw 268 anti-LGBTQ+ incidents, many at parades and other Pride events—a nearly 400 percent increase from June 2022.
